Red Curry

Red curry is a popular Thai dish. The delicious Red Thai Curry is a rich, healthy meal packed full of bright flavors and hearty vegetables. It’s warm and perfect for cool days.

It is made up of several varieties of  Red hot chilies as its base, Coconut milk,tomatoes and plenty of aromatics, like onion, ginger and garlic, and lemongrass.

Red curry is hotter than  green curry.This is because red curry contains more chili peppers than other types of curries.

Green Curry

Wonderful Green Thai Curry is a healthy and comforting meal packed with the vibrant fresh hot chillies as its base, lemon grass, basil, coconut milk and green coriander leaves, and loaded with the choicest vegetables.

Green curry is spicy but not as much as red curry.Its  ??flavor is milder and sweeter.

Red vs. Green Curry: How They’re Similar 

There are a few similarities between these Thai curries. Common spices that you’ll see in both the curries are a variety of hot chillies, Coconut milk, garlic, shallot, cumin, chili powder, turmeric, coriander, and cilantro. Both dishes typically have lemongrass as part of their base ingredients and they are dishes from Thailand.

The major ingredient used in making them is “Chilies.” The red curry is made with red chilies, green curry is a product of green chilies.

How does Red curry differ from Green curry?

Red curry and Green curry are two Thai food staples that have become popular in recent times.

Despite similarities in how the two curry pastes are made, green curry and red curry do have noticeable differences. Let’s compare.

The main difference between red curry and green curry is that Red Curry is made from a blend of several varieties of  Red hot chilies as its base, tomatoes which gives it a spicy and tangy taste and other aromatic ingredients. It is the most versatile curry and can be paired well with most food items whereas 

Green Thai Curry is more or less similar to the red Thai curry, except that it gets its signature color from the green chillies.

Green curry is made from blending different varieties of green chillies as its base, basil, coriander and lime leaf to enhance the flavor and green tinge. and certain aromatic ingredients.

It pairs especially well with fish and rice. This curry gets its distinct color from its ingredients basil, coriander and green chillies.

Red Curry vs Green Curry: Factors to Compare. 

Comparison Table Between Red Curry and Green 

Parameter of ComparisonRed CurryGreen Curry
Flavor Red curry has a bolder flavor and more depth.
Green curry’s flavor is milder and sweeter.
IngredientsRed hot chillies, Coconut milk, tomatoes, lemon grass, garlic, shallot, cumin, chili powder, turmeric, coriander, and cilantroGreen chilies, Coconut milk, lemongrass, basil, mint, lemons, cumin, shallots, ginger, green bell peppers.
Color Red curry gets its signature color from red chillies and tomatoes.Green curry gets its distinct color from green chillies, basil, cilantro and coriander. 
Spice Red curry is spicier than green curry.It is made of 20 Red chilies. It usually ranks a 5/5 in spice levels.Green curry has a brighter and sharper taste.It usually ranks between a 2 or 3 out of 5 in the level of spice.
Ingredients UsedRed hot chillies, Coconut milk, tomatoes, lemon grass, garlic, shallot, cumin, chili powder, turmeric, coriander, and cilantroGreen chilies, Coconut milk, lemongrass, basil, mint, lemons, cumin, shallots, ginger, green bell peppers.
ConsistencyRed Curry has thin Soupy like consistency.Green curry is thicker than red curry and can be made thinner with coconut milk or water.
Alternative namesIn the Thai language, red curry is called gaeng phed. It translates as “spicy soup”Green curry is known as “sweet green curry” or gaeng keow wahn in the local language.
